Day 1
You will meet your private safari guide at Arusha airport or at your accommodation in Arusha. On this day, you can choose to go to Tarangire National Park or Lake Manyara National Park. Depending on the time of year, each of these parks offers different safari experiences. Your guide can advise you as to which is best to visit during your safari. If Tarangire National Park, you'll depart from Arusha after breakfast for the approximately two-hour drive to Tarangire National Park. Along the way, you'll pass bustling Maasai villages and the vast, open plains that have become synonymous with images of Africa. If Lake Manyara National Park, you'll depart from Arusha after breakfast for the drive to Lake Manyara National Park. The journey takes approximately two hours, but we'll pass through the market town of Mto wa Mbu along the way. This agricultural and fresh produce market is a melting pot of local cultures and a souvenir hunter's paradise. Day 2
After a hearty breakfast, we'll kick off the day early in anticipation of an exciting exploration. Our journey will begin with a picturesque drive towards the Serengeti. En route, we'll traverse the misty rainforests of the Ngorongoro Conservation Area, where you might be fortunate enough to catch a glimpse of Cape buffalo, baboons, or even elephants and leopards concealed within the dense undergrowth. Following a delectable lunch at the Serengeti National Park picnic area, it's time to immerse ourselves in the heart of the Serengeti. Prepare to be captivated by the iconic African savannah landscape and the sheer multitude of animals that freely roam these vast grassy plains. As the day comes to a close, you'll enjoy a delightful dinner and spend the night in the heart of the Serengeti National Park, with your accommodation chosen according to your preferred standard and type. Day 3
Today you can choose when you will do game drive and when you want to relax in the lodge. You can wake before dawn to take part in a sunrise game drive. It's an ideal time to see lions, leopards, and cheetahs in action as well as the early morning movements of the wildebeest, zebra, and other herbivores. After your unforgettable morning, you'll return to your lodge for a late breakfast and to freshen up before hitting the road again with a picnic lunch / or to stay in the lodge in the afternoon. You can also have a normal morning game drive after breakfast, and return to the lodge for hot lunch. From 1 pm till 3 pm it is more hot than the rest of the day, so you might as well stay in the lodge after lunch, and start another game drive in the late afternoon. You have another option to take to the skies with a sunrise hot air balloon safari and champagne breakfast. Day 5
After breakfast, you'll head to Ngorongoro Crater, often regarded as the Eighth Wonder of the World. Upon your first glimpse of this immense, green caldera from the panoramic viewpoint, you'll quickly grasp why it has garnered such a prestigious reputation. The Ngorongoro Conservation Area is home to over 120 mammal species, including the renowned Big Five, making it one of the world's most coveted safari destinations. It's an excellent place to witness the endangered black rhinoceros peacefully grazing on the grassy plains and observe numerous hippos enjoying the refreshing waters. The crater harbors a substantial population of predators, such as lions, leopards, cheetahs, jackals, and hyenas, as well as an abundance of wildebeest, zebras, antelope, Cape buffalo, and more. It unquestionably ranks among Africa's top safari destinations. You will then enjoy a picnic lunch by the park’s renowned hippo pool, before returning to Arusha Airport or your hotel in Arusha.
